When Thailand companies expand their operations to Delhi, India, they may encounter various challenges that require effective troubleshooting strategies to overcome. From cultural differences to regulatory hurdles, successfully navigating these obstacles can determine the success of a business venture in a new market. In this blog post, we will explore some common troubleshooting issues that Thailand companies may face in Delhi, India, along with practical solutions to address them. Cultural Differences: One of the most significant challenges when doing business in a foreign country is understanding and adapting to the local culture. Bangkok and Delhi may seem worlds apart in terms of customs, communication styles, and business practices. To bridge this cultural gap, it is crucial for Thailand companies to invest in cultural sensitivity training for their employees working in Delhi. Building relationships based on mutual understanding and respect can help in navigating cultural differences and establishing strong business connections in the local market. Regulatory Compliance: Navigating the complex regulatory landscape in Delhi, India, can be daunting for foreign companies, including those from Thailand. From tax regulations to labor laws, understanding and ensuring compliance with local regulations is paramount to avoiding legal issues that can hinder business operations. Partnering with local legal experts and consultants who specialize in Indian laws can provide Thailand companies with valuable guidance on regulatory compliance and help mitigate the risks associated with non-compliance. Supply Chain Challenges: Managing supply chains effectively is vital for Thailand companies operating in Delhi, where logistics and transportation systems may differ from what they are accustomed to in Thailand. To troubleshoot supply chain challenges, companies can consider working with local suppliers and logistics partners who have a strong understanding of the market and can help streamline operations. Implementing robust inventory management systems and optimizing transportation routes can also enhance efficiency and reduce costs in the supply chain. Human Resource Management: Recruiting and retaining top talent in Delhi can be a competitive endeavor for Thailand companies, especially in industries with high demand for skilled professionals. Developing a comprehensive HR strategy that includes competitive compensation packages, training and development opportunities, and a positive work culture can help attract and retain the best employees in the market. Investing in employee engagement initiatives and fostering a diverse and inclusive workplace can also contribute to long-term success in human resource management.
